Product Description

The truth you need to know before you buy a franchise

This straight-shooting franchise guide goes beyond the “how-to” to teach you what to expect when starting a franchise. Real-life stories from the trenches illustrate to you how to cope with the difficulties a franchise presents. Smart Franchising reveals the personality types most likely to succeed at franchising and warns you about the character traits that may increase the risk of failure. Plus, it offers an in-depth look at what happens during the research and investigation of a franchise, something glossed over in most franchise books.

1 out of 5 stars Waste of Money -- Suspicious of Other Reviews   May 11, 2008
 7 out of 8 found this review helpful

I have read four or five books on purchasing a franchise and this is clearly the worst. The books from Nolo are the best and the Better Business Bureau are second. This book is mostly hype about how great the franchise experience can be with pep talks and nonsense about how you are good enough to be in the 1 percent of successful franchise buyers. The information is neither objective nor balanced. I encourage people to always look at who the writers are to see if the source can be trusted. In this case it is consultants who make their money training people who sell franchises, helping people franchise their existing business and selling coaching services to existing franchisees. They have no vested interest in discouraging you from buying a franchise. Spend your money on a different book. I am suspicious of the other rave reviews, it looks like a marketing campaign to me. It is hard for me to believe real people found value in this book.
